Título: | Mapping the Moho beneath the Southern Urals with wide-angle reflections |
Autor: | Carbonell, Ramón CSIC ORCID ; Lecerf, D.; Itzin, M.; Gallart Muset, Josep CSIC ORCID; Brown, Dennis CSIC ORCID | Fecha de publicación: | 1998 | Editor: | American Geophysical Union | Citación: | Geophysical Research Letters 25: 4229-4232 (1998) | Resumen: | A stack of the wide-angle reflection/refraction component of the URSEIS-95 experiment provides the first well-resolved imaged of the Moho beneath the southern Urals. The processing consisted of low pass filter (0-6 Hz), CMP sorting, and a NMO correction without stretch. The PmP phase, a very narrow band and low frequency (up to 6 Hz) wavelet, changes character from west to east along the transect. In the depth converted section, the Moho reaches a maximum depth of 53±2 km beneath the Magnitogorsk arc. Thickness estimates determined from high amplitudes at near critical distances also support a 53 km thick crust. A selective offset stack consisting of traces at 150-250 km offset indicate an undulating, irregular Moho, suggesting either strong lateral velocity variations or high topographic relief beneath the Magnitogorsk arc. | URI: | http://hdl.handle.net/10261/170761 | DOI: | 10.1029/1998GL900107 | Identificadores: | doi: 10.1029/1998GL900107 issn: 1944-8007 |
